DXGKCB_SYNCHRONIZE_EXECUTION callback function (dispmprt.h)

The DxgkCbSynchronizeExecution function synchronizes a specified function, implemented by the display miniport driver, with the display miniport driver's DxgkDdiInterruptRoutine function.

Syntax

DXGKCB_SYNCHRONIZE_EXECUTION DxgkcbSynchronizeExecution;

NTSTATUS DxgkcbSynchronizeExecution(
  [in]  HANDLE DeviceHandle,
  [in]  PKSYNCHRONIZE_ROUTINE SynchronizeRoutine,
  [in]  PVOID Context,
  [in]  ULONG MessageNumber,
  [out] PBOOLEAN ReturnValue
)
{...}

Parameters

[in] DeviceHandle

A handle that represents a display adapter. The display miniport driver previously obtained this handle in the DeviceHandle member of the DXGKRNL_INTERFACE structure that was passed to DxgkDdiStartDevice.

[in] SynchronizeRoutine

A pointer to a function, implemented by the display miniport driver, that will be synchronized with DxgkDdiInterruptRoutine. The function must conform to the following prototype:

BOOLEAN SynchronizeRoutine(PVOID Context);

[in] Context

A pointer to a context block, created by the display miniport driver, that will be passed to SynchronizeRoutine.

[in] MessageNumber

The number of the interrupt message with which SynchronizeRoutine will be synchronized. If the interrupt is line-based, this parameter must be zero.

[out] ReturnValue

A pointer to a Boolean variable that receives the return value of SynchronizeRoutine.

Return value

DxgkCbSynchronizeExecution returns one of the following values:

Return code Description
STATUS_SUCCESS The function succeeded.
STATUS_INVALID_PARAMETER One of the parameters is invalid.
STATUS_UNSUCCESSFUL The function was unable to synchronize execution, possibly because the interrupt had not been connected yet.

Requirements

Requirement Value
Minimum supported client Available in Windows Vista and later versions of the Windows operating systems.
Target Platform Desktop
Header dispmprt.h (include Dispmprt.h)
IRQL <=DISPATCH_LEVEL
